Now, for the important part...

I contacted my Senator’s office a few days ago and explained how long I have been waiting for my NOA2. They sent me a form to fill out that basically said I was going to be working with them and that I agree to disclose information about my case to the Senators office. The Senators office told me at the six month mark they are authorized to call the USCIS and expedite my request. I gave them all of my information and waited for the six month mark. I wake up on 29 APR 11 (6 month mark) and get the email from the Senators office stating that they called the Vermont Center and my case has been expedited. I had, to say the least, little faith that my case would really be expedited.

Flash forward a few hours after receiving the email from the Senators Office.. I get a email from the USCIS stating that my service request (made previously) had been processed and that my case was with a case office pending review.(I submitted a service request about 2 weeks ago, hoping to get any information I could). I was devastated; my service request was just the standard "We're working on it" response. I did find it strange that I received my service request only a few hours the Senators office expedited my request. I woke up this morning (I am in Afghanistan) and discovered that my NOA2 had been emailed to me at 8:30pm Vermont time. Either the computer sent the response after closing hours, the service center is open until 8:30pm, or someone had to work late because the Senator called and forced them. I really hope someone was forced to work late. It’s funny how a call from a Senator can get a sevice request and a NOA2 knocked out on the same day. SHAME ON YOU VERMONT SERVICE CENTER.

Moral of this post - Call you senators office and ask them for any help. I was very humble in my request to them and now am forever grateful.

Good luck all those out there waiting for NOA2 - Get your Senators involved at around the 5 month mark.

I would try a different Senators office, even in a different state!!! They never asked me if I was a resident of Kansas (Senators office I called). I lived in Kansas growing up, but live in Washington D.C now. Call any Senators office you want!! Give it a try, worst that can happen is that it wont work.
